A traffic collision involving two vehicles, a semi truck and a Kia, occurred this morning on Interstate 5 North at the Gyle Road On-Ramp in Gerber, CA. The incident was reported at approximately 4:54 AM, with the smaller vehicle colliding into the back of the semi truck. Fortunately, both vehicles remained drivable following the crash.
Emergency services quickly arrived to secure the scene and manage traffic flow. Relevant lane closures were enforced, which may have caused delays for morning commuters. Traffic management teams worked diligently to minimize congestion and ensure the safety of all drivers in the area.
A tow truck was called to assist with the Kia, which sustained damage from the collision. The tow truck was expected to arrive shortly after the initial response, allowing for the safe removal of the vehicle from the roadway.
